Checkmk Raw Edition: Serious Monitoring Without a SaaS Bill

There’s lightweight monitoring, and then there’s Checkmk — the kind of tool that says, “You want deep metrics? OK. Here’s everything.” And the Raw Edition gives you all of that without any licensing nonsense or cloud lock-in.

It’s based on Nagios under the hood — but don’t let that scare you. Checkmk adds a real web UI, automated discovery, performance graphs, smart service checks, and better scaling. It turns the old-school Nagios model into something much more usable.

If you’ve got a fleet of Linux servers, network gear, or random SNMP devices, and want visibility without gluing together Prometheus, exporters, Grafana, and alert rules from scratch — Checkmk might be what you need.

What It Does (Out of the Box)

Feature What It Brings to the Table
Agent-based monitoring Lightweight agents for Linux/Windows, installed in seconds
SNMP support Switches, printers, routers — auto-detects hundreds of device types
Web UI Inventory, dashboards, host/service views, and graphing
Rule-based configuration Fine-grained control over thresholds, check intervals, and alerts
Nagios-compatible core Uses core Nagios engine for proven alerting performance
Graphing via RRD + PNP4Nagios Integrated historical views for any metric
Bulk discovery Detects dozens of services on hosts automatically
Plugin library Tons of checks for databases, storage, cloud, containers, etc.
Email/SMS/Script alerts Custom notifications with flexible rules
Completely self-hosted No data leaves your network — full control

Who Uses Checkmk Raw (And Why)

It’s not for hobbyists. This is the kind of tool you run on a real VM, behind a proper reverse proxy, probably with backups.

Good fits:
– IT departments monitoring 50+ hosts or services
– Teams replacing Zabbix, Nagios, or Icinga with something more modern
– Environments that include both Linux and Windows systems
– Admins who want visibility into services like Apache, MySQL, systemd, RAID, smartd, etc.
– Teams that need alerts and historical graphs, without setting up Prometheus stacks

Raw Edition makes most sense when you want the power of Nagios — but with a web UI and auto-discovery you can actually live with.

Installation (On Debian/Ubuntu, Fast Way)

1. Download the latest `.deb` package from:
https://checkmk.com/download-raw

2. Install dependencies:
sudo apt install -y xinetd apache2 rrdtool php

3. Install Checkmk:
sudo dpkg -i check-mk-raw-*.deb

4. Create a monitoring site:
sudo omd create mysite
sudo omd start mysite

5. Access web UI:
http://yourhost/mysite

6. Add agents or configure SNMP hosts — start discovering services.

Honest Observations

– The UI is functional, not beautiful — it’s for work, not dashboards on a TV
– Takes time to learn the rules and logic — but it scales well once set up
– Good docs, but deep features aren’t always obvious at first
– PNP4Nagios graphs are basic but reliable
– Agent updates are manual unless you script deployment
– Raw Edition has no central cloud — good for privacy, but you manage everything

Checkmk Raw is not for everyone. But if you need full-stack, reliable monitoring that doesn’t depend on third-party clouds — and you don’t mind getting your hands dirty — it’s one of the best tools you can run on-prem.
